Tour of Berkeley's Gourmet Ghetto

Culinary walking tours are every Thursday from 2 - 5 pm. For more information, visit www.inthekitchenwithlisa.com or www.gourmetghetto.org.

The weekly tours will feature conversations with the area's chefs and food purveyors, as well as a mouth-watering assortment of tastings and samples. Stops on the tour through the historic culinary mecca will include the original Peet's Coffee in Walnut Square, the eclectic food shops at Epicurious Gardens, the Vintage Berkeley Wine Shop, and the area's weekly all-organic Farmers' Market. Along the way, tour participants will get to learn more about and taste some of the following local artisan edibles:

    Lisa Rogovin, epicurean concierge, is bringing her passion for Bay Area artisan food and wine businesses to the new tour, which will offer behind the scenes experiences at a revolving selection of restaurants and food shops along with a discussion of the area's history as the birthplace of California Cuisine spearheaded by Alice Waters' Chez Panisse. Northern California is one of the most exciting places in the world for food and it's because growers and eaters take all aspects of food extremely seriously.
